In recent years, environmentalists have raised concerns about the future of food. Every year, 1.3 billion tons of food are consciously thrown away by consumers while over one-tenth of the population still go hungry. Many governments have started to take remedial action to reduce food waste. Since 2013, for example, the US government has launched the Food Waste Challenge, encouraging restaurants, schools and universities to make contact with hunger relief organizations like food banks and pantries. It also forces food manufacturers and stores to improve their product storage systems through which food can be kept longer. In addition, food suppliers are required to recycle their discarded but unexpired products to feed animals or create compost, bioenergy and natural fertilizers. In Viet Nam, diners at some buffet restaurants have to make a heavy charge for extra amounts of leftovers whereas some food retailers offer a big discount on near-expired products.
